the brazing went well, better than i expected. My little jig worked great (minus the wood idea, retarded i know) and i really didn’t have that much clean up to do. I choose 56% silver for the job and TJ cautioned that since i’d be working with the fork blades and stays that i watch my temperature, which was a little hard considering the size of the torch tip but overall it worked quite well.
